DAY 4: CASTELO BRANCO / SANTAR / VISEU / LAMEGO

Explore the Dão demarcated wine region, located in the center of the country. This is a beautiful region, surrounded by the Serra de Estrela Mountains, provides a special microclimate and excellent conditions for grape ripening. Visit and do a wine tasting at the “ Casa de Santar”, DOC Dão, one vast wine estate located between Nelas and Viseu. Before arriving to Lamego, you will stop to visit Viseu, capital of the district, popular for its colorful gardens, its Cathedral, and lovely old churches. Then, you will arrive at Lamego, a medieval town located at 12 km from the Douro Valley, city of the Temples and Sanctuaries, here you will have the opportunity to visit and admire the impressive “Nossa Senhora dos Remedios” Sanctuary. Time to check-in and accommodation.

 

DAY 5: LAMEGO / PINHÃO / RÉGUA / PORTO

The Douro Valley is a fantastic region with spectacular landscapes and wine properties located along the Douro river. This region is UNESCO heritage and it’s known as the “Fairy Valley”. It has its origins in the territorial delimitation of 1756, the date of the first demarcation of the “Vinhos do Alto Douro”, which defined the first institutional model of organization of a wine region worldwide. Originally established to regulate the production of the wine that we call “Porto wine”, the traditional local ‘DOC’ meaning Controlled Designation of Origin for Port and Douro wines. You will discover the village of Pinhão on the Douro shore. Here you will enjoy a boat trip and admire the vineyards, wine estates and the beautiful palaces or manor houses which can be overlooked at the both shores of the river. Next stop will be in Peso da Régua, a village located in the heart of Douro Valley, where you are going to visit one of the many wineries and taste the wines produced here. Then, you will head towards Porto to overnight.

 

DAY 6: PORTO

After breakfast, you will explore the city of Porto, capital of Northern Portugal, located by the Douro river shore and famous for the 58 Porto wine cellars existing here. One of Europe’s most astonishing cityscapes, Porto’s old quarter, with its thick flagstones and delicately-moulded façades attracts more and more culture-hungry tourists. UNESCO was so impressed with its patrimonial importance that classified this part of downtown Porto as a World Heritage Site in 1996, stating that the city’s historic center, built along the hillsides overlooking the mouth of the River Douro, forms an exceptional urban landscape with a thousand- year history. You will have the chance to admire: the old Cathedral, the Clérigos Tower (once the highest building in town), the narrow medieval streets, churches, and palaces. The guided tour will end with a visit followed by a Port wine tasting at one of the wine cellars existing in town. Afternoon at leisure.
